我已经签约存储用户提供的照片,用于通过Facebook进行的比赛。我目前在将文件从Facebook上传到我的服务器时遇到问题(我知道他们会在帖子请求中删除文件变量,但我看到的所有答案都只是说“使用iframe”。我的应用程序设置为iframe(与FBML,在应用程序设置中)。
这对于排除故障并启动和运行来说是非常耗时的(我试图只销售远程图片的URL存储,这被拒绝了)。我正在考虑将图像保存为我的mysql数据库中的blob。我们希望能够拍摄约2,000张各种尺寸的照片。这类负载的一般情况是什么?我已经阅读了各种讨论多个TB数据的SO线程,文件系统是一个更好的选择,但对于一两个人来说,这是不合理的吗?
由于
答案 0 :(得分:1)
考虑到照片的数量,将它们存储为斑点并不合理。我在SQL Server中有类似数字的兆字节大小的图片,对我的系统没有任何不利影响。但是,YMMV和我建议您编写一个简单的MySQL Db,并将适用大小的2或3,000个图片推入,并查看系统的行为方式。你应该能够在很短的时间内完成这项工作。